Northampton station is well-equipped with essential facilities to ensure a seamless travel experience. The ticket office operates from 06:00 to 19:00 on weekdays and Saturdays, while extending its hours on Sundays from 07:00 to 20:00. Ticket machines and smartcard validators are accessible, making it convenient for passengers to purchase or collect their tickets.
For those requiring assistance, help is readily available at multiple points, and the station provides useful resources such as departure screens and announcements. Although there is no luggage storage, the station is under the Secure Station Scheme, ensuring a safe environment with CCTV coverage.
Additional amenities enhance your travel comfort—refresh with a drink from Soho Piccolo Coffee Shop or a quick read at WHSmith. Although there is no public Wi-Fi or payphones available, the station surrounds promise connectivity options for modern travelers.
Northampton train station prides itself on accessibility, providing step-free access throughout and ticket barriers. All platforms are accessible, making it exceptionally convenient for those with reduced mobility. The provision of ramps, accessible toilets, and staff assistance ensures a comfortable journey for every passenger.
Car park facilities, operated by SABA UK, are open 24/7 with a capacity of 866 spaces including 12 accessible spaces. Payment for parking includes various methods like the Saba Parking UK app, a convenient option for anyone driving to the station.
The seamless transition from train travel to other transport modes is a vital feature of Northampton station. Rail replacement services operate from the car park side of the station, ensuring minimal disruption during planned maintenance or unexpected rail service changes. Taxis are easily accessible from the front of the station, and local bus information is available, making planning onward journeys straightforward.
For those inclined to take a green approach, bicycle storage is available with 85 spaces in sheltered stands, monitored by CCTV. Although bike hire facilities are not present, this provision encourages eco-friendly travel within Northampton.

Cuffley station is well-equipped with ticket buying and collection facilities, including a ticket office with convenient hours throughout the week and automated ticket machines. For tech-savvy travelers, smartcards are issued and validated here, ensuring quick and efficient access. Importantly, these machines acc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, although it's advised to verify the station's map and accessibility details prior to travel.
Help and support are significant priorities at Cuffley, with staff available Monday to Sunday to assist passengers' needs. Platforms are equipped with customer information screens and announcement services to keep you informed. However, it's worth noting the incomplete step-free access, with only the southbound platform to London offering such convenience. Anyone requiring additional support can take advantage of the staff-operated ramps to facilitate train access, ensuring a smooth transition from platform to vehicle.
Refresh your journey at the station’s available refreshment facilities, although bear in mind that there are no waiting rooms or baby changing amenities on site. For a touch of added convenience, 272 parking spaces await travelers, with 10 designated as accessible, monitored around-the-clock by CCTV for peace of mind. Cyclists can find stands for 18 bicycles by the entrance, though bikes are parked at the owner's risk.
Making your onward journey easy, taxis are available directly from the station’s front, providing flexible local connections. Alternatively, excellent local bus services link up here, with travel information available to ensure seamless planning. Rail replacement services occasionally operate when necessary, emphasizing the station's commitment to maintaining uninterrupted service.
